Next week will mark Valentine's Day around the world, which is mostly the big day of the flower, chocolate and greeting card business.
Precisely in the run-up to the annual celebration, an English company due to "Moonpig" managed to complicate itself especially, and on the way also Cristiano Ronaldo, whose name went against his will into an embarrassing affair.
One of the special greeting cards prepared by the company in honor of February 14 pasted a picture of the Manchester United star against the caption "Nothing will stop me from conquering on this Valentine's Day."
The not-so-subtle allusion to sexual conquest immediately drew a slew of angry reactions, and the company that realized the magnitude of the mistake quickly removed the blessing from its website.

The shock of surfers who managed to be exposed to the wording of the greeting before it was removed stems, of course, from the affair in which Ronaldo was accused of raping former model Catherine Mayorga in Las Vegas in 2009.
The case is already closed, but this week it made headlines following the New York Times' intention to publish new evidence on the subject, and Ronaldo's opposition to it.
The apology issued by the company immediately read: "We never intended to hurt anyone. We are proud of our ability to make our customers happy, and when concerns arose about this specific card we removed it at that moment."
